Transaction 53c708c930ff6ca50e146a4fc122f2f5c0482e1efcf8cc3f664536b6cc6f8b73

64 Input
1 Outputs
  • 53c708c930ff6ca50e146a4fc122f2f5c0482e1efcf8cc3f664536b6cc6f8b73:0
  • value  12864884992
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h